Competing In Gliding

(N.Z. Press Association) AUCKLAND, April 27. New Zealand will compete in the world gliding championships in Bristol next month for the first time since 1956. Taking part will be the chief Instructor of the Auckland Gliding Club, A. Cameron, who left today to join R. Georgeson and G. Westrena (Christchurch) and R. Handley (Blenheim), who are already in England. Mr Georgeson represented New Zealand in the world titles in Paris in 1952.
